Step-by-step explanation:
Information given
\(\bar X=130\) represent the sample mean
\(s=40\) represent the sample standard deviation
\(n=80\) sample size
\(\mu_o =120\) represent the value to verify
t would represent the statistic
\(p_v\) represent the p value
System of hypothesis
We want to verify if shoppers participating in the loyalty program spent more on average than typical shoppers (120) , the system of hypothesis would be:
Null hypothesis:\(\mu \leq 120\)
Alternative hypothesis:\(\mu > 120\)
The statistic for this case is given by:
\(t=\frac{\bar X-\mu_o}{\frac{s}{\sqrt{n}}}\) (1)
Replacing the info given we got:
\(t=\frac{130-120}{\frac{40}{\sqrt{80}}}=2.236\)
Now we can find the degrees of freedom:
\(df=n-1=80-1=79\)
Now we can calculate the p value with the alternative hypothesis using the following probability:
\(p_v =P(t_{(79)}>2.236)=0.0141\)
Using a significance level of 0.01 or 1% we have enough evidence to FAIL to reject the null hypothesis and we can conclude that shoppers participating in the loyalty program NOT spent more on average than typical shopper at this significance level assumed

Complete the expression so that it is equivalent to 2 (x+6)
The complete expression is (2 × x) + (2 × 6). This is an equivalent expression to the given expression.
What is an expression?
A number, a variable, or a combination of numbers, variables, and operation symbols make up an expression. Two expressions joined by an equal sign form an equation.
Given expression is
2 (x+6)
Distributive property: The same outcome is obtained by multiplying the sum of two or more addends by a number as it is by multiplying each addend by the number separately and combining the resulting products.
The mathematical representation is a(b+c) = ab + ac.
Apply the Distributive property in the given expression:
(2×x) + (2×6)

What is an equation of the line that passes through the point (8, 2) and is
parallel to the line 5x – 4y = 36?
Step-by-step explanation:
5x - 4y = 36
4y = 5x - 36
y = 1.25x - 9
Since this line has a slope of 1.25, the parallel line will also have a slope of 1.25.
=> y = 1.25x + c
When x = 8, y = 2.
=> (2) = 1.25(8) + c
=> 2 = 10 + c, c = -8
Hence the line equation is y = 1.25x - 8.
